• An analytical solution of the Colebrook–White equation is provided.
• The friction factor can be calculated with arbitrary accuracy.
• The whole (ϵ/D)-Re-space(ϵ/D)-Re-space can be calculated.
• Examples for practical applications are given.
It is shown that the Colebrook–White equation 1/λ=−2lg[2.51/Reλ+ϵ/3.71D] can be solved analytically for the friction factor λ . The solution contains two infinite sums. For given Reynolds numbers ReRe and relative roughnesses ϵ/Dϵ/D, one can create an own approximation with the required accuracy by adding a finite number of summands. The computing time of both the iterative calculation and several approximations is being compared. In all cases, the approximation is much faster than the iteration. Two examples for practical applications are given.
